Artwork Appreciation
KAO Ya-Ting’s works have always focused upon the contradictory attraction and separation between the human race and nature, and the artist employs art to illustrate her fantasies and imaginations. KAO Ya-Ting is skilled in using brilliant tones to create a natural visage that leads viewers into an abstract visual experience. Kingbee No. 7 is an artwork of her Hive series. Bright, neon colors were used to create a male portrait. The man’s body, however, is surrounded by a dense mantle of colorful bees, leaving only his face and hair exposed. People naturally will not place bees upon themselves. KAO Ya-Ting’s work of a man covered in bees is employed as a critique of the human fantasy of mastering nature itself, infused with her personal ideas and communicating her fantasies and observations of the urban and the natural world.
